Jets Secure Captain Adam Lowry with Five-Year, $25M Extension

The Winnipeg Jets have strengthened their roster by securing their captain, Adam Lowry, with a significant contract extension. The team announced on Wednesday that Lowry will remain with them for another five years in a deal worth $25 million.

Contract Details

This extension solidifies Lowry’s position as a key player for the Jets. The new contract comes after he previously played under a five-year, $16.25 million agreement that he signed in April 2021.

Player Background

Adam Lowry, at 32 years old, has been with the Winnipeg Jets since they drafted him in the third round of the 2011 NHL Draft. He has become an integral part of the team’s identity.

Career Statistics

  • Total Career Games Played: 782
  • Total Goals: 122
  • Total Assists: 154

This season, Lowry has faced challenges, appearing in only seven games so far due to a hip surgery he underwent in May. He made his season debut on November 4, contributing one goal and two assists to the Jets’ efforts.
